In this week’s Writing Tip Wednesday, we’re helping you guide your first and second graders through planning personal narratives with a simple, effective tool: the circle map. Organizing thoughts before writing is crucial, especially for young students who are still learning to structure their ideas. A circle map provides an easy way for students to brainstorm and focus on the details that make their stories more engaging.

In today’s episode, we’ll talk about:

  • What a circle map is and why it works for young writers
  • How to introduce the circle map with a whole-class example
  • A step-by-step guide for students to create their own circle maps
  • Tips for helping students brainstorm sensory details for richer narratives
  • How to use the circle map as a guide for writing personal stories
